Imprisonment On The Go! (Continued)

Description
This is a continuation of Imprisonment On The Go! (Make Pawns Prisoners Without Beds) originally created by AgentBlac.

So far nothing has been changed about how this mod works compared to its predecessor. I've created new source files by decompiling the assembly, cleaned up the decompiled code so that it looks like a human being wrote it, and recompiled it against the current RimWorld assembly.


This mod makes it possible to capture downed pawns as prisoners without the need to have a securely enclosed prisoner bed on the same map. Such prisoners are shackled and slow-moving, but could still make an attempt to escape if not secured by the time they regain their mobility.


When you have downed an enemy pawn, simply select one of your colonists, then right click the downed enemy and select the Imprison option from the float menu. It's as simple as that.
